Job Summary

 
Huble is an international creative, digital business and CRM consultancy with Elite HubSpot Partner status, delivering strategic solutions across marketing, sales, service, websites, and operations. This Full Stack Development Team Lead role combines hands-on architectural responsibilities with team leadership, focusing on designing scalable HubSpot-based solutions, managing developers, and driving technical excellence across frontend and backend systems.

Job Description

 

Huble is seeking an experienced Full Stack Development Team Lead to join its Development team, reporting to the Head of Development. This role combines hands-on architectural design with team leadership responsibilities, focusing on delivering scalable, high-quality HubSpot solutions across frontend and backend systems. The successful candidate will collaborate with cross-functional teams to translate business requirements into robust technical implementations.


Responsibilities:
- Architect and design scalable full-stack solutions on the HubSpot platform.
- Lead frontend and backend development using modern frameworks and best practices.
- Provide mentorship, conduct code reviews, and guide technical standards across the team.
- Collaborate with project managers, designers, and consultants to define technical specifications.
- Develop and maintain APIs, integrations, workflows, and custom UI extensions.
- Manage team capacity, allocate tasks, and ensure timely, high-quality project delivery.


Requirements:
- Relevant qualification in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or related field.
- Minimum 8 years of full-stack development experience across frontend and backend technologies.
- At least 2 years of team leadership or technical lead experience.
- Strong proficiency in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, React or Angular, and backend technologies such as Node.js, Python, or PHP.
- Experience with RESTful APIs, GraphQL, CI/CD pipelines, and architectural design patterns.
- In-depth knowledge of HubSpot products, APIs, and custom integrations.
